Expert Committee

Exea Impact is supported by an expert committee for its initiative «Loneliness in Childhood and Adolescence in Times of Hyperconnectivity»

Mar España Martí

Mar España Martí

Mar España holds a law degree and leads Plataforma Control Z, an initiative dedicated to making the digital world more human and protecting health and fundamental rights. She is also the President and co-founder of FUNDEVAS, an NGO focused on neurodevelopment, health, and early bonding during the first 1,000 days of life. She previously served as Director of the Spanish Data Protection Agency (AEPD).

María Salmerón Ruiz

Dr. María Salmerón is a paediatrician at Hospital Ruber Internacional and Centro Comienzo. She serves as President of SEMA and coordinates the Digital Health Working Group at the Spanish Association of Paediatrics (AEP). She advises institutions including the European Union, the AEPD, and various ministries on the impact of digital environments on health. María is also a researcher, speaker, and author of scientific and public-facing publications, and regularly collaborates with the media.

David Ezpeleta Echávarri

David Ezpeleta holds a degree in Medicine from the University of Navarra. He works as a neurologist at the Hospital San Juan de Dios in Pamplona and at the Vithas Institute of Neurosciences in Madrid, which he directs. He serves as Vice President of the Spanish Society of Neurology, where he leads the areas of Neurotechnology and Artificial Intelligence, as well as History and Culture.

Miquel Àngel Prats Fernández

Miquel Àngel Prats is a teacher, educational psychologist, and holds a PhD in Pedagogy. He is currently an Associate Professor of Educational Technology and the lead researcher of the eduTIC line within the PSITIC research group (Pedagogy, Society, Innovation, and ICT) at the Blanquerna Faculty of Psychology, Education, and Sport of Ramon Llull University. He is an expert in pedagogical innovation and ICT.
